﻿.main_image {width:100%; height:243px;  overflow:hidden; margin:0 auto; position:relative;}
.main_image ul {width:9999px; height:243px; overflow:hidden; position:absolute; top:0; left:0}
.main_image li {float:left; width:100%; height:243px;}
.main_image li span {display:block; width:100%; height:243px;}
.main_image li a {display:block; width:100%; height:243px}
.main_image li .img_1 {background: url('../images/banner1.jpg') center top no-repeat; background-size:100%}
.main_image li .img_2 {background: url('../images/banner2.jpg') center top no-repeat; background-size:100%}
.main_image li .img_3 {background: url('../images/banner3.jpg') center top no-repeat; background-size:100%}
div.flicking_con {width:100%; display:block; float:left; position:relative;}
div.flicking_con .flicking_inner {position:absolute; top:-25px; left:0px; z-index:999; width:100%; background:url(../images/bg.png); height:25px;}
div.flicking_con a {float:left; width:15px; height:15px; margin:0; padding:0; background:#999;-moz-border-radius: 15px;
-webkit-border-radius: 15px;border-radius: 15px; margin-right:5px; text-indent:-1000px; margin-top:5px;}
div.flicking_con a.on {background:#3da0fd}
#btn_prev,#btn_next{z-index:11111;position:absolute;display:block;width:73px!important;height:74px!important;top:50%;margin-top:-37px;display:none;}
#btn_prev{background:url(../images/hover_left.png) no-repeat left top;left:100px;}
#btn_next{background:url(../images/hover_right.png) no-repeat right top;right:100px;}